Output fd8ea75ae58c6e44e3606d011d7fbd1b4a89b587da40a30a8d30eff38cd62a5e:0

value
418317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ae5471c20f53724f33f022d6efafadf0e5751700 OP_EQUAL
address
3HanfDhVxKXsoJP2p2LhmLait7xK5ZDqtS
transaction
fd8ea75ae58c6e44e3606d011d7fbd1b4a89b587da40a30a8d30eff38cd62a5e
spent
true